Solo organ recital

  • Canterbury Cathedral (map)

Robin gives a short solo recital, which follows on from choral evensong. Entrance is free with a retiring collection.

This concert includes the World Premiere of Frederick Frahm’s Babbitt Sonata. This three-movement work is inspired by ‘Babbitt’ written by Sinclair Lewis in 1922.

Also, Dietrich Buxtehude’s extended choral prelude on “Nun Freut Euch, Lieben Christen Gmein” BuxWV 210, and Alexandre Guilmant’s March on a theme of Handel “Lift up your heads”.
